solid as a rock vs unchangeable

solid as a rock

adj
  • Extremely thick and heavy, so as to make it impossible to move. 

  • Very reliable and dependable 

unchangeable

noun
  • Something that cannot be changed. 

adj
  • Not changeable; incapable of being changed or of changing; immutable. 

How often have the words solid as a rock and unchangeable occurred in a corpus of books? (source: Google Ngram Viewer )